In an epic leap that has the entire startup ecosystem buzzing, Jumbotail, India’s fast-growing B2B marketplace for food and grocery, has officially entered unicorn territory after raising $120 million in its Series D funding round.

With the backing of SC Ventures (the investment arm of Standard Chartered Plc) and other investors, Jumbotail’s valuation has skyrocketed to an estimated $950 million, with expectations to cross the $1 billion mark soon. Breaking Down the $120 Million Investment: Who’s Behind It?

So, who’s putting their money where their mouth is? SC Ventures has led this massive funding round, injecting $81.6 million into the company, while Artal Asia chipped in with another $5.1 million.

  • Standard Chartered Group will take an 8.12% stake, cementing its influence in this $1 billion-valued unicorn.
  • The capital raised will allow Jumbotail to expand rapidly, invest in advanced technology, and broaden its presence across India’s growing food and grocery market.

But the investment doesn’t stop there. Jumbotail is in talks to raise Rs 734 crore (around $87 million) to fuel its next growth phase, ensuring that its $1 billion valuation is just the beginning.


Jumbotail’s New Power Play: Acquisition of Solv India

In a move that signals their intention to dominate the market, Jumbotail recently acquired Solv India, a supply chain tech company. The acquisition, which has been approved by the Competition Commission of India, allows Jumbotail to integrate even more innovative technologies into its platform, further improving product distribution and logistics solutions for its users.

With this acquisition, Jumbotail now offers a more comprehensive end-to-end solution for its clients, enabling smoother operations across the food and grocery supply chain.
